Publishing for the PreK-12 Market 2021-2022 from Simba Information addresses the opportunities in the PreK-12 school market and the strategies at work in the industry that provides instructional materials to schools.
Simba Information defines the major segments of instructional materials industry—core basal curriculum, courseware, state-level tests, digital supplements, print supplements, manipulatives, trade books, video and classroom magazines—and sizes the individual segments and the overall instructional materials industry, which Simba projects will come in at $9.31 billion in 2021.
The seven-chapter analysis in Publishing for the PreK-12 Market 2021-2022 focuses on market trends and the size and structure of the industry. Among explored topics are: Connectivity issues and status at school and at home. Impact of federal stimulus spending. Fiscal 2022 funding initiatives in eight of the largest states. Sales by industry segments. Increased digital development. Upended testing plans. Operating performance of selected public companies. Preponderance of digitally-driven M&A activity. Projected sales of instructional materials by segment through 2024.Additionally, 12 company profiles provide a look at the variety and focus of various providers if instructional materials.
